Origin PC has recently exposed their latest gaming laptop, called the Origin PC EON17. It is the third EON series gaming notebook. The Origin EON17 is coming with a multi-gesture touchpad, instant access buttons and a full size keyboard with a numeric pad.
Newly Origin PC EON17 gaming notebook is boasts up to Intel Core i7 980X desktop quad-core or hexa-core processors, up to 24GB of Triple Channel DDR3 memory, up to Dual NVIDIA GeForce GTX 480M graphics cards in SLI, and up to three HDD (1TB of total capacity) or up to 512GB SSD.
Origin EON17 laptop is packs a 17.3-inch Full HD widescreen display with resolution of 1920 x 1080 pixel and 16.9 aspect ratio, HDMI in/out, DVI out, and 7.1 HD audio system with five speakers and a subwoofer. It has also a DVD or Blu-ray drive, an 88.8WHr battery, a 9-in-1 card reader, and pre-loaded with Windows 7 Home Premium, Professional or Ultimate (64bit).
The price of Origin PC EON17 gaming laptop is starts from $2,499.

The Origin EON18 Gaming Notebook packs exactly what we’ve come to expect into a high end gaming system. The unit offers an Intel Core i7-920XM Extreme Processor, packs a punch with 8GB DDR3 RAM and offers plenty of graphical kick back with a NVIDIA GeForce GTX 285M graphics card outputting on an 18.4 inch Full HD Display.
The system also provides users with three SSD slots available in various RAID configurations and a Blu-ray player with burner built in. The unit also offers programmable gaming keys and touch -sensitive display shortcuts.
